The Role of Satellite Tracking in Global Shipping

Every day, over 90% of global trade is carried by sea. The massive scale of maritime operations makes visibility a crucial challenge.
Traditional vessel tracking systems often suffer from limited coverage, especially in remote waters. This is where satellite-based AIS (Automatic Identification System) comes in — providing real-time monitoring of ships anywhere in the world.

How Satellite Tracking Works
Satellite tracking integrates multiple data streams to provide accurate visibility:
- AIS Transponders: Installed on ships to send identification, speed, and route data.
- Earth Observation Satellites: Capture weather, sea temperature, and navigation conditions.
- Global Data Networks: Combine satellite data with port and customs systems for smarter trade logistics.
- AI & Predictive Analytics: Analyze patterns for route optimization, delay prediction, and risk management.
This seamless system allows traders, freight forwarders, and customs authorities to act faster and more precisely.

Case Studies of Satellite-Enabled Trade
Maersk Line, one of the world’s largest shipping companies, uses satellite-based analytics to track fleet performance and reduce idle time.
The European Maritime Safety Agency (EMSA) operates CleanSeaNet — a satellite system that monitors oil spills and illegal discharges.
Iran and Persian Gulf shipping operators have started adopting AIS tracking to strengthen transparency and meet international standards.

Challenges of Implementing Satellite Tracking
Despite its advantages, some barriers remain:
- High Data Costs: Satellite communication can be expensive for smaller fleets.
- Data Security Risks: Sensitive route data requires strict encryption and cyber protection.
- Integration with Legacy Systems: Many ports still lack full digital readiness.
- Privacy Concerns: Sharing vessel data across borders can raise regulatory issues.
Still, with growing international cooperation and AI-driven systems, these challenges are rapidly being addressed.

FAQs
What is AIS and how does it relate to satellite tracking
AIS (Automatic Identification System) transmits a ship’s identity, position, and speed. Satellites extend its coverage globally.
How does satellite tracking reduce trade risks
It helps detect suspicious movements, forecast weather disruptions, and ensure compliance with trade regulations.
